Question
Find the Income of Suleiman? Statement I: Suleiman's income exceeds Salman's by Rs. 8000, and Salman's savings amount to Rs. 15,000. Statement II: The income of Salman and Salma is in the ratio 9:8, while their expenditures are in the ratio 5:4. Salma's savings are Rs. 10,000 less than Suleiman's savings.
The question consists of two statements I and II given below it. You have to decide whether the data provided in the statements are sufficient to answer the question or not.
